On 9/29/14, 1:08 AM, Andres Freund wrote:
> On 2014-09-28 20:32:30 -0400, Gregory Smith wrote:
>> There are already a wide range of human readable time interval output
>> formats available in the database; see the list at
http://www.postgresql.org/docs/current/static/datatype-datetime.html#INTERVAL-STYLE-OUTPUT-TABLE
> He's talking about psql's \timing...

I got that.  My point was that even though psql's timing report is kind 
of a quick thing hacked into there, if it were revised I'd expect two 
things will happen eventually:

-Asking if any of the the interval conversion code can be re-used for 
this purpose, rather than adding yet another custom to one code path 
"standard".

-Asking if this should really just be treated like a full interval 
instead, and then overlapping with a significant amount of that baggage 
so that you have all the existing format choices.
